1

Senior Java Developer Relocation Jobs in Virginia

JAVA Developer IAM role

Richmond, VA · On-site +1

$50.50 - $65.25/hr

IAM SENIOR JAVA DEVELOPER The candidate's key responsibilities will be: * Design, develop, and maintain Java-based applications with a focus on authentication and authorization integration.

Sr. Java Developer

Richmond, VA

$56.75 - $72.25/hr

Sr. Java Developer Arete Technologies, Inc. offers a set of innovative consulting and outsourcing services, bridging the gap between requirements and outputs of various dexterous and facile companies ...

Sr. Java Developer

Chantilly, VA · On-site

$58.50 - $74.75/hr

Company Description Contract Title: Sr. Java Developer Location: Washington, DC Locals to DC/MD/VA only Direct 1 step F2F Length: 12+Months TOP SKILLS: Core Java, Angular JS, web services, Oracle ...

Senior Java Developer

Richmond, VA · Hybrid

$56.75 - $72.25/hr

Job Title: Development - App Dev - Java - Sr Backend Software Engineer Java, Springboot, AWS, CI/CD, SQL databases Modernizing applications on IAM documents and messaging Must sit in McLean, VA ...

Java Developer

Mclean, VA · On-site

$51.50 - $66.75/hr

Senior Java Developer (Angular + AWS + Microservices) Location: [McLean , VA / Local Candidates] Employment Type: Contract Job Overview: We are seeking a highly skilled Senior Java Developer with ...

Senior Java Developer

Alexandria, VA · On-site

$61.25 - $78.25/hr

Overview: client is seeking a Senior Java Developer with extensive Spring and Hibernate experience to join our client on a rapidly growing Agile Development Program! This is an opportunity to apply ...

Senior Java Developer

Sterling, VA · On-site

$56.75 - $72.25/hr

Senior Java Developer Job Category: Information Technology Time Type: Full time Minimum Clearance Required to Start: TS/SCI with Polygraph Employee Type: Regular Percentage of Travel Required: Up to ...

Sr. Java Developer

Lorton, VA · On-site

$58 - $73.75/hr

Company Description This position is for one of our Clients, located in Lorton, VA is seeking a Senior Java software engineer with minimum 7 years experience with hands on Java experience with proven ...

Senior Java Developer

Roanoke, VA

$56.25 - $71.75/hr

Exploris Senior Developer Advance Auto Parts is seeking a Senior Developer who loves to build ... Java * TDD * Jsp * Spring Boot * RDBMS * Proficient in following languages: * Perl * Python * PHP ...

Sr. Java Developer

Lorton, VA · On-site

$58 - $73.75/hr

Company Description This position is for one of our Clients, located in Lorton, VA is seeking a Senior Java software engineer with minimum 7 years experience with hands on Java experience with proven ...

Senior Java Developer

Mclean, VA · On-site

$57.75 - $73.75/hr

This role involves senior Java development skills for event-based systems using Spring Boot, Microservices, and Kafka Streaming. Key Responsibilities: * Senior Java development * Event-based systems

Senior Java Developer

Chantilly, VA · On-site

$58.50 - $74.75/hr

AFS is seeking a Senior Java Developer to work in a fast-paced, Agile environment. The ideal candidate will participate in the full Agile application development life cycle for new development design ...

Java Fullstack Developer

Glen Allen, VA · On-site

$49.50 - $64/hr

Company Description Health Care Client Senior Java Developer: 6+ years Java Development- (Full Stack) Java EE - "EE" stands for Enterprise Edition. Experience with one or more Javascript frameworks ...

Senior Java Developer

Fairfax, VA · On-site

$58.50 - $74.50/hr

Senior Java Developer Category: Software Development/ Engineering Main location: United States, Virginia, Fairfax Position ID:J0626-0110 Employment Type: Full Time Position Description: CGI is ...

Senior Java Developer

Fairfax, VA · On-site

$58.50 - $74.50/hr

Senior Java Developer Category: Software Development/ Engineering Main location: United States, Virginia, Fairfax Position ID:J0526-0231 Employment Type: Full Time U.S. - Finding purpose at CGI By ...

Sr. Java Developer

Richmond, VA · On-site

$56.75 - $72.25/hr

DMAS Prog Analyst 5 - Java Complete Description :* This position will serve as a senior application developer for the DMAS Information Management Division in the design, development, and maintenance ...

next page

Showing results 1-20

Senior Java Developer Relocation information

What is the difference between Senior Java Developer Relocation vs Java Software Engineer?

AspectSenior Java Developer RelocationJava Software Engineer
Required CredentialsBachelor's in CS, Java certifications, 5+ years experienceBachelor's in CS or related field, Java knowledge, 2+ years experience
Work EnvironmentLarge enterprise, tech firms, remote or onsiteStartups, tech companies, remote or onsite
Industry UsageCommon in finance, healthcare, techCommon in software development, IT services
Search & Comparison IntentOften compared for seniority, relocation benefitsCompared for entry to mid-level Java roles

While both roles involve Java development, Senior Java Developer Relocation typically requires more experience, seniority, and may involve relocating for senior positions. Java Software Engineer is often an entry to mid-level role focused on software development. The main difference lies in experience level and job seniority, with the relocation aspect more relevant for senior roles.

What are the most commonly searched types of Java Developer Relocation jobs in Virginia? The most popular types of Java Developer Relocation jobs in Virginia are:
What are popular job titles related to Senior Java Developer Relocation jobs in Virginia? For Senior Java Developer Relocation jobs in Virginia, the most frequently searched job titles are:
What job categories do people searching Senior Java Developer Relocation jobs in Virginia look for? The top searched job categories for Senior Java Developer Relocation jobs in Virginia are:
What cities in Virginia are hiring for Senior Java Developer Relocation jobs? Cities in Virginia with the most Senior Java Developer Relocation job openings:
JAVA Developer IAM role

JAVA Developer IAM role

RIT Solutions, Inc.

Richmond, VA • On-site, Remote

$50.50 - $65.25/hr

Other

This job post has expired today. Applications are no longer accepted.


Job description

Title: JAVA Developer IAM roleLocation: Richmond, VA - mostly remote - however, need someone local to go onsite when needed
Senior Java developer who will build, enhance, and secure identity-aware applications that integrate with Microsoft Entra and Okta. This role will focus on implementing robust authentication/authorization mechanisms using industry-standard IAM protocols and ensuring alignment with our overall security strategy.
IAM SENIOR JAVA DEVELOPER
The candidate's key responsibilities will be:

  • Design, develop, and maintain Java-based applications with a focus on authentication and authorization integration.
  • Implement SSO, MFA, and token-based authentication using OAuth2, OIDC, and SAML.
  • Refactor existing applications to integrate with Microsoft Entra or Okta.
  • Design, implement, and maintain secure RESTful APIs to support cross-platform integrations.
  • Collaborate with the IAM Integration Lead, security engineers, and administrators to ensure consistent adoption of IAM standards.
  • Write clean, efficient, and testable code following best practices.
  • Participate in code reviews, peer mentoring, and technical design discussions.
  • Troubleshoot and resolve production issues related to authentication and user access.
  • Contribute to automation of application deployment and integration using CI/CD pipelines.

Minimum qualifications are the essential, non-negotiable requirements a candidate must meet to be considered for the position.
  • 8+ years of hands-on experience in software development with 2+ years of experience guiding and mentoring junior developers.
  • A bachelor's degree in computer science, software engineering, or a related field.
  • In-depth knowledge and proficiency in the Java programming language.
  • Comprehensive knowledge of Java frameworks such as Spring, Hibernate, and others.
  • Design, develop, and maintain Java-based applications with a strong emphasis on authentication and authorization integration.
  • Strong understanding of the Java security frameworks with proven hands-on implementation experience.
  • Experience in designing and implementing RESTful and SOAP web services.
  • Extensive Knowledge of software design patterns and the ability to apply them in real- world scenarios.
  • Strong analytical and problem-solving skills with debugging skills to troubleshoot complex issues.
  • Familiarity with software development methodologies (e.g. Agile and Scrum)
  • Experience optimizing Java applications for performance and scalability.
  • Awareness of Java security principles and best practices.